Subject: [PATCH 3/7] s390/vfio_ap: use TAPQ to verify reset in progress completes
Date: Tue, 13 Dec 2022 10:44:33 -0500	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20221213154437.15480-4-akrowiak@linux.ibm.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20221213154437.15480-1-akrowiak@linux.ibm.com>

To eliminate the repeated calls to the PQAP(ZAPQ) function to verify that
a reset in progress completed successfully and ensure that error response
codes get appropriately logged, let's call the apq_reset_check() function
when the ZAPQ response code indicates that a reset that is already in
progress.

 drivers/s390/crypto/vfio_ap_ops.c | 24 +++++++++++++-----------
 1 file changed, 13 insertions(+), 11 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/s390/crypto/vfio_ap_ops.c b/drivers/s390/crypto/vfio_ap_ops.c
index a5530a46cf31..5bf2d93ae8af 100644
--- a/drivers/s390/crypto/vfio_ap_ops.c
+++ b/drivers/s390/crypto/vfio_ap_ops.c
@@ -33,7 +33,7 @@
 static int vfio_ap_mdev_reset_queues(struct ap_queue_table *qtable);
 static struct vfio_ap_queue *vfio_ap_find_queue(int apqn);
 static const struct vfio_device_ops vfio_ap_matrix_dev_ops;
-static int vfio_ap_mdev_reset_queue(struct vfio_ap_queue *q, unsigned int retry);
+static int vfio_ap_mdev_reset_queue(struct vfio_ap_queue *q);
 
 /**
  * get_update_locks_for_kvm: Acquire the locks required to dynamically update a
@@ -1632,8 +1632,7 @@ static int apq_reset_check(struct vfio_ap_queue *q)
 	return ret;
 }
 
-static int vfio_ap_mdev_reset_queue(struct vfio_ap_queue *q,
-				    unsigned int retry)
+static int vfio_ap_mdev_reset_queue(struct vfio_ap_queue *q)
 {
 	struct ap_queue_status status;
 	int ret;
@@ -1648,12 +1647,15 @@ static int vfio_ap_mdev_reset_queue(struct vfio_ap_queue *q,
 		ret = 0;
 		break;
 	case AP_RESPONSE_RESET_IN_PROGRESS:
-		if (retry--) {
-			msleep(20);
-			goto retry_zapq;
-		}
-		ret = -EBUSY;
-		break;
+		/*
+		 * There is a reset issued by another process in progress. Let's wait
+		 * for that to complete. Since we have no idea whether it was a RAPQ or
+		 * ZAPQ, then if it completes successfully, let's issue the ZAPQ.
+		 */
+		ret = apq_reset_check(q);
+		if (ret)
+			break;
+		goto retry_zapq;
 	case AP_RESPONSE_Q_NOT_AVAIL:
 	case AP_RESPONSE_DECONFIGURED:
 	case AP_RESPONSE_CHECKSTOPPED:
@@ -1688,7 +1690,7 @@ static int vfio_ap_mdev_reset_queues(struct ap_queue_table *qtable)
 	struct vfio_ap_queue *q;
 
 	hash_for_each(qtable->queues, loop_cursor, q, mdev_qnode) {
-		ret = vfio_ap_mdev_reset_queue(q, 1);
+		ret = vfio_ap_mdev_reset_queue(q);
 		/*
 		 * Regardless whether a queue turns out to be busy, or
 		 * is not operational, we need to continue resetting
@@ -1931,7 +1933,7 @@ void vfio_ap_mdev_remove_queue(struct ap_device *apdev)
 		}
 	}
 
-	vfio_ap_mdev_reset_queue(q, 1);
+	vfio_ap_mdev_reset_queue(q);
 	dev_set_drvdata(&apdev->device, NULL);
 	kfree(q);
 	release_update_locks_for_mdev(matrix_mdev);
